Bhutan Embraces Crypto Tourism, Becomes First Nation to Implement National Payment System

Bhutan has taken a pioneering step by partnering with Binance and DK Bank to launch the world’s first national-level cryptocurrency tourism system. This innovative initiative allows travelers with Binance accounts to pay for almost all aspects of their journey using cryptocurrencies. From airfare to hotel bookings, monument entries, tour guides, and even local fruit vendors, visitors can now utilize these digital assets throughout their trip. 100 local merchants have already been integrated into the system, though specific names haven’t been disclosed. 100+ c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in (BTC) and USD Coin (USDC) are supported via QR codes within the Binance app, ensuring seamless transactions for tourists. While visitors pay in crypto, merchants receive their payment in local currency through DK Bank, Bhutan’s digital bank officially licensed by the Royal Monetary Authority of Bhutan.
